当前位置: 移动技术网 > IT编程>开发语言>JavaScript > 前端解析zip文件

前端解析zip文件

2018年12月14日  | 移动技术网IT编程  | 我要评论
使用jszip.js,read.js. 传入fileinput选中的文件对象 function handleFile(f) { JSZip.loadAsync(f) .then(function(zip) { vm.$data.zipFileArry = []; zip.forEach(functi ...

使用jszip.js,read.js.

 

 

传入fileinput选中的文件对象

function handlefile(f) {
jszip.loadasync(f)
.then(function(zip) {
vm.$data.zipfilearry = [];
zip.foreach(function(relativepath, zipentry) {
let name = zipentry.name;
if(name.indexof('.html') > -1) {
vm.$data.zipfilearry.push({
"name": name
});
$zipitemtable.bootstraptable('load', vm.$data.zipfilearry);//结合bootstrap-table使用
}
});
}, function(e) {
$result.append($("<div>", {
"class": "alert alert-danger",
text: "error reading " + f.name + ": " + e.message
}));
});
}

如您对本文有疑问或者有任何想说的,请 点击进行留言回复,万千网友为您解惑!

相关文章:

验证码:
移动技术网